Once you know the Stingtail was an idea pawned off the board game because GSG were (and still are) so desperately out of ideas they had to take them from ancillary media, you begin to understand why they feel so terrible in the video game. They're an enemy that's only designed to work in a turn-based setting.

In the board game you have to sacrifice your actions to run away from a Stingtail grab, which is annoying but not insurmountable, especially since you have time to plan your actions. In the video game, you get grabbed by a Stingtail and then you just instantly die to the cohort of Slashers following it. If you get grabbed, there's nothing you can do about it unless you're Scout or you have the Dash perk. You can't even reliably stun Stingtails because the fucking things are clad head-to-toe in heavy armour. It's like they deliberately made the video game Stingtail to be as annoying and un-interactive as possible.

What's really funny is that the board game Stingtail actually looks significantly better, too. The video game Stingtail looks nothing like a Glyphid, it doesn't even have a visible mouth.
